MEMO — Finance Team
Re: Licensing dispute with Kelverton Systems

Kelverton has challenged our continued use of the Orbix-Lite rendering module, claiming our enterprise licence lapsed when the Brantley agreement was restructured. Counsel believes our position is defensible, but litigation costs could exceed the renewal fee. We have accrued a provision in this quarter's accounts and paused further deployments of the module pending resolution. Settlement talks begin next week, and the outcome will shape our strategy.

board note of kageg-bahof: The renewal with Holwynax Holdings closes at $2 million a year, 5 percent below the last contract. Project Ulaath slips by two quarters because of the supplier delay.

To the release manager: I'm passing ownership of the Pellwick deep-link router to Sorrel before the 4.2 cut. The intent-matching table now lives in the Farrowgate config service; stale entries were purged last sprint. Watch the fallback route — it silently swallows malformed slugs, which inflated our drop-off metrics in March. The staging resolver needs its keystore unlocked before each regression pass, and that keystore accepts only one credential. For the signing vault, the recovery phrase is noted directly below.

recovery phrase for tafog-fafog: novix-novdor-fraath-brieth-olieth-oliix-rusix-wenion-julax-druox

Ticket: Drift between cron hosts and Spindle workflow defs

The cron-to-Spindle migration is half done. Four jobs run in both places; two run in neither. Someone edited the Spindle schedules directly in staging, so the repo no longer matches reality. Before the next release cut, we need to freeze cron edits, reconcile the workflow definitions against the repo, and delete the legacy crontab entries. Blocking the release until confirmed. For reference, the agreed target configuration we are reconciling toward is listed below.

deployment values, fadug-bawif:
SORWYN_LOG_LEVEL=debug
SORWYN_METRICS_HOST=metrics.sorwyn.qirvansys.internal
SORWYN_POOL_SIZE=32